Install BIOS Update. Once the download process completes, it is now time to install the BIOS update. Go to your download location and run the downloaded BIOS update file. Click on Yes if the system asks for any confirmation. Click on Update . Once the firmware data loads, the system should restart automatically.Aug 22, 2023 · From there, you choose the BIOS-updating option, select the BIOS file you placed on the USB drive, and the BIOS updates to the new version. How to access the BIOS or UEFI. Turn on the computer. At the Dell logo screen, press the F2 key several times until you enter the BIOS or System Setup. Alternatively, press the F12 key several times until you see the One Time Boot Menu and then select BIOS Setup or System Setup from the menu. Examples: Update the system silently: Filename.exe /s. Change from the default log location (example target path: C:\my path with spaces\log.txt) Filename.exe /l="C:\my path with spaces\log.txt". Force update to continue (even on "soft" qualification errors): Filename.exe /s /f. If the ability to remotely update the Dell BIOS across a …
